Domestic terror suspect dies in FBI standoff, Puerto Rican nationalist sought in 1983 Wells Fargo robbery (story)


HORMIGUEROS, Puerto Rico (AP) -- A Puerto Rican nationalist leader wanted in a 1983 robbery of a Connecticut armored truck died during an FBI stakeout, ending 15 years on the run, the island's police chief said Saturday.

A gunbattle erupted on Friday as FBI agents closed in to arrest Filiberto Ojeda Rios, 72, in a farmhouse in the western town of Hormigueros, Pedro Toledo said.
